Satej Dyandeo Patil (Marathi: सतेज ज्ञानदेव पाटील) (born 12 April 1972) is the former Minister of State for Home (Urban & Rural),Rural Development, Food & Drugs Administration of Maharashtra state in central India. He is a leader of the Indian National Congress from Maharashtra state.He is son of Padma Shri Dr.D. Y. Patil. Satej D Patil is from the city of Kolhapur in the Kolhapur district of Maharashtra. He is popularly known as Bunty among the masses.
